In this video, I'm going to show you how to remove and replace the headlights on this 2006 Malibu sedan, same as the Malibu Maxx as well. I show you both replacing the entire headlight assembly, as well as just replacing the bulbs.
Maybe you've gotten into a little accident or something, or a rock took out one of your headlights, or maybe as you can see on this vehicle in the before, you want to take your kind of clouded, faded headlights and replace them with nice new headlights from 1A Auto you can see in this after picture. It only takes about ten minutes, or five or ten minutes per side. All's you need is a 10 mm wrench. Again, you can go from an old car looking like this, take a bunch of miles, and it looks like this.
With the hood open, it's pretty easy. There are two 10 mm bolts, one here and one here. We use a 10 mm wrench or a socket and ratchet. Now I'll just speed up here as I remove those two bolts. Now lift the light up and out. You got a connector right here. You pull back on this tab and disconnect it. If you're looking to replace bulbs, you just twist these covers right off. The bulbs are inside. You can twist and pull the bulb out. Then remove the harness, so you have to pry out all these kind of ears here. Pull the harness down and off. Then the re-installation is just the reverse. Same thing for the parking side marker, it just pulls out of the socket. Push it back in.
Here's the new light from 1A Auto. You can see how much more clear it is. The only thing you're going to want to do is on the back of your old one, there's a little clip right here. Pull it off, use a small screwdriver, kind of keep your thumb on it. Pull out. Take it off. Lay it aside. Get into our new headlight. Right down here push it on. Headlight down. Plug it in. There's two pins that go into holes right down here. Just make sure those go down in. The gasket fits all flush. We'll speed it up here again as I start those two 10 mm bolts in, and then tighten them up with the socket and ratchet.
